Lauren is entering her 3rd year as the Assistant Athletic Director for Compliance. She previously spent eight seasons as the Assistant Volleyball Coach at William Carey.
 
Broom, a Mandeville, Louisiana native, first arrived in Hattiesburg in 2007 to play volleyball at the University of Southern Mississippi. During her playing career for the Lady Eagles, she was named a team captain for the 2009 and 2010 seasons. She was also a part of the 2009 Conference USA Championship team, something that hasn’t happened at USM since. Upon finishing her career, Broom stayed on the staff at USM as a student coach in 2012.
 
Following her days at USM, Broom moved to Petal Primary as a teacher. During that time, she continued to coach volleyball for local club teams. In 2016, Broom joined the staff at William Carey for the inaugural volleyball season as an assistant, where she spent the next eight seasons. In 2020, Broom helped lead the Lady Crusaders to the school’s first ever appearance in the NAIA National Tournament. The following year, Carey Volleyball won the school’s first ever SSAC Regular Season Championship.
 
As an assistant, Broom coached nine SSAC First-Team All-Conference players, nine SSAC Second-Team All-Conference players, two SSAC Freshmen of the Year, and one SSAC Setter of the Year. In 2018, Broom helped lead William Carey in the school’s first ever Beach Volleyball season and finished with a 6-2 record.
 
Broom earned her Bachelor of Science in Elementary Education in 2012 from Southern Miss and her Master of Education in Elementary Education in 2014, also from USM. In 2016, she received her Specialist Degree in Instructional Leadership from William Carey. In addition to her role in the athletic department, Broom is also an instructor in the William Carey School of Education.
